Definitions of collapsable word
- adjective collapsable capable of collapsing or of being collapsed, as for carrying or storing. 1
- noun collapsable something that is collapsible: The auditorium chairs are collapsibles that store easily. 1
- noun collapsable Alternative spelling of collapsible. 1

Origin of collapsable
First appearance:
before 1835 One of the 34% newest English words
First recorded in 1835-45; collapse + -ible
